Who might be able to join this trial:

  • You have a new or returning appointment at the BC Women's Centre for Pelvic Pain and Endometriosis.
  • You have previously agreed to be contacted for future research through the centre's data registry.
  • You have endometriosis that has been confirmed by surgery, shown on imaging, or suspected by a doctor at your appointment.
  • You are between 19 and 49 years old.
  • You are willing and able to complete six questionnaires about pain.
  • You are willing and able to take part in a type of physical sensitivity testing called QST (confirm with trial site for details on what this involves).

Who may not be able to join:

  • You are currently pregnant or breastfeeding.
  • You have gone through menopause.
  • You do not speak English.
  • You have diabetes or a nerve-related condition that causes pain (for the QST part of the study).
  • You have previously had a large surgical cut on your abdomen (for the QST part of the study).
  • You have had surgery, scarring, or physical injury to specific areas of the body used during the sensitivity testing — specifically the shoulder muscle area or the base of the thumb (for the QST part of the study).
